Get in Touch** The Ford repair market in Chesterfield, MO, is characterized by a strong dealership presence and a select few highly specialized independent shops. The average quality of service is high, reflecting the affluent and demanding demographic of the area. Competition is robust, pushing shops to maintain high standards of customer service and technical capability. * **Pricing Tier:** Dave Sinclair Ford, as the dealership, operates at the premium end of the pricing spectrum for parts and labor. Independent specialists like Lombard Auto Service and A-1 Auto Center typically offer more competitive labor rates while still providing OEM or high-quality aftermarket parts, presenting a strong value proposition. * **Specialization:** For factory-specified repairs, warranty work, and the most complex module programming, the dealership is the necessary choice. For ongoing maintenance, performance-oriented service, and complex diagnostics outside of warranty, the independent specialists are often preferred for their personalized service, lower costs, and deep, brand-specific expertise. * **Service Gap:** A noticeable gap exists for independent shops specializing explicitly in Ford performance tuning and Mustang builds within the immediate Chesterfield city limits. Enthusiasts often travel to broader St. Louis-area specialists for these highly specific services.

In Chesterfield, common issues include transmission problems in models like the Focus and Fiesta, as well as EcoBoost engine carbon buildup from frequent stop-and-go traffic on roads like Clarkson and Olive. The local climate also leads to increased wear on batteries and brake components due to seasonal temperature extremes.
Look for shops that are ASE-certified and have specific Ford or Motorcraft training. In Chesterfield, many quality independent shops, like those on Chesterfield Airport Road, offer factory-level diagnostics and parts, often at lower rates than the dealership, so check for local reviews and specialized service bays.
Seek service immediately if you notice harsh shifting, slipping, or delayed acceleration, especially on Chesterfield's hills. Regular transmission fluid checks and changes are crucial, as the area's varied terrain from highways to suburban streets can accelerate wear on Ford's automatic transmissions.
Typically, yes, the dealership has higher labor rates, but they use OEM parts and have the latest factory-specific tools. For complex computer or warranty work, the dealership on Chesterfield Parkway West may be best, but for routine maintenance, trusted local independents often provide significant savings.
Chesterfield's winter road treatments and summer humidity necessitate more frequent undercarriage washes to prevent rust and more diligent air conditioning service. Also, consider more frequent brake inspections due to the constant construction and heavy traffic on major corridors like Highway 40/64.
